    • HerbcoFoodH HerbcoFood

      I cooked the last of the NY strip that I dry aged for 60 days, cooked in the sous vide at 129°, then 1 minutes on each side on the 700° grill. We did a taste test to see which we liked more. The Uncle Chris’ won, the cowboy crust is missing some onion and garlic to it.
